Chief and chaplain of the Stilkin, forever raging against the Citadel that chokes their caves and sees them suffer. This one's strength was much enhanced by stolen soul. They are not the first who tried to hoard it, or to mould it towards such violent ends.

Background

Groal leads the Stilkin of Bilewater and channels fury at the Citadel’s pollution. Beside his arena sits a hut with a strung‑up Snail Shaman, Seeker’s Soul, and rows of soul vials—evidence of stolen arts. His Needolin echoes ‘Swirling, pale flame… Obey me!’ betray how the power has warped him.

In-Game Events

At Bilehaven’s upper pools, you must clear six enemy waves before Groal erupts from the muck to begin the fight. After his defeat, Stilkin Trappers begin spawning across Bilewater, signaling disrupted territory.

Behaviour & Tactics

All hits 2 Masks. Groal often submerges, re‑emerging to hover and fire off 1–2 attacks. Splashes telegraph surfacing for Groal and his Stilkin. • Acid Spit: Two arcing orbs bounce once then pop (vanish if they land in water). • Great Inhale: Wide cone pull; being swallowed deals ticking damage until mashing free. Pimpillo/Voltvessel thrown into his mouth cause choking damage. • Spike Ball Ambush: Stays underwater and deploys a swinging trap that arcs across the arena (edge platforms safe). • Stilkin Ambush: Summons two Stilkin/Trappers to pop up under mid platforms for a single attack. • Soul Phase (≤390 HP): Emits Vengeful Spirit in 2–3 bursts aligned to your position (first time always three). Tips: Corners/going under water avoid the swinging trap; Wreath of Purity mitigates infestation; bait from one side to cluster ambush spawns.
